Water treatment services involve the installation, maintenance, and repair of systems designed to improve the quality of water supplied to residential and commercial properties. These services often include the assessment of water sources, the installation of filtration units, water softeners, and other treatment devices, as well as ongoing system upkeep. The goal is to ensure that water meets safety standards and is suitable for household or business use, addressing issues related to impurities, sediments, and undesirable tastes or odors.
These services help resolve common water-related problems such as hard water buildup, which can cause scale deposits and damage appliances, and contamination from bacteria, chemicals, or heavy metals that may pose health risks. Additionally, water treatment can eliminate unpleasant tastes and odors, improve clarity, and extend the lifespan of plumbing fixtures and appliances. Regular maintenance and system upgrades can also prevent costly repairs and ensure consistent water quality over time.

Water Treatment Service Costs - The typical cost for water treatment services ranges from $300 to $1,500, depending on system size and complexity. For example, installing a standard whole-house filtration system might cost around $800. Prices vary based on the specific needs and local service providers.
Filter Replacement Expenses - Filter replacement services generally cost between $50 and $200 per visit, with larger or more advanced filters on the higher end. Routine replacements for standard filters are usually around $75. Costs depend on the type and number of filters used.
System Installation Fees - Installing a new water treatment system can range from $1,000 to $4,000, influenced by system type and installation requirements. A basic under-sink filter might cost approximately $1,200, while whole-house systems are more expensive. Prices are affected by local labor rates and system features.
Maintenance Service Charges - Regular maintenance visits typically cost between $150 and $400, depending on the scope of service. Comprehensive tune-ups or system checks generally fall within this range. Costs vary based on system complexity and local service provider rates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
